winber1
no it's pretty worthless

if you're going to use it to train you really need to know what you're doing. there is an enormous amount of coordination between your cursor movement and your clicking. Unless you click or you move your cursor like the AI does, then you are often training something completely irrelevant. and no one moves or clicks like the AI.

Fatal015
They're both good for their separate tasks.
For example Autopilot can be used for training your tapping hand with speed or stamina while Relax can help with your aim.
But ultimately, you need to practice without any mods so your hands get used to playing together.
